I have a corn that's my display snake who's kept in a room that usually gets around 74-78. The temps in the room drop overnight too to about 70-72. I have a regulated UTH that's always on to give him a hotspot in case he gets colder and to digest. Corns and Kings are hardy snakes and I haven't had problems with mine.
